  • Paprick is a common butcher, carving slabs of meat from gargantuan monsters so elite chefs can prepare magic-granting meals for the rich. But Paprick's true passion is cooking, and if he can learn the secret art, his dreams of liberating his people and sharing the monsters' magic with the world could come true. He steals the precious ingredients needed to practise recipes at home, but if he's caught, he'll be executed. As his desperation grows, he ventures into the black market and uncovers a spice imported from unknown lands. Combining it with the last of his stolen meat, he cooks a dish the world has never tasted before, with side-effects he couldn't have foreseen. The dish's magic grows Paprick to a monstrous size, and legends of his powers spread among the people. Immediately, the rulers arrest him, but Paprick convinces them to make him a chef's apprentice-if they ever want to learn his recipe. However, his exposure to the world of high cuisine reveals the rot at its centre, and with his new power, rebellion is only a few recipes away...
